Six Weeks Until Broadway Smash PETER AND THE STARCATCHER Arrives In Sydney

The highly anticipated production of the five-time Tony Award-winning play Peter and the Starcatcher arrives in Sydney in just six weeks’ time. The Broadway smash hit begins at the Capitol Theatre on 31 January for a strictly limited season before it heads to Brisbane.

Peter and the Starcatcher is the untold story of Neverland. Before Neverland, there was an island. Before Captain Hook, a pirate. Before Wendy, her mother Molly. Before Peter, a nameless boy.

The star-studded ensemble cast including Otis Dhanji from blockbuster Aquaman and Netflix hit The Unlisted as Boy / Peter; comedian Peter Helliar, loved for his screen work on The Project, Have You Been Paying Attention? and I’m A Celebrity Get Me Out Of Here, as Smee; one of Australia’s most recognisable comedy faces, Colin Lane from duo Lano & Woodley, as Black Stache; and television star Olivia Deeble, known for roles on Home and Away, More Than This and Secret Society of Second Born Royals, as Molly.

Also featuring in the Peter Pan prequel story is Alison Whyte (Death of a Salesman, The Dressmaker) as Lord Aster; Paul Capsis (La Cage aux Folles, The Rocky Horror Show) as Slank and Hawking Clam; Ryan Gonzalez (Moulin Rouge! The Musical, In The Heights) as Fighting Prawn; Hugh Parker (The Office, The Family Law) as Captain Scott; Morgan Francis (Boy, Lost) as Prentiss; John Batchelor (Sea Patrol, Red Dog) as Alf; Lucy Goleby (Harry Potter and the Cursed Child) as Mrs Bumbrake and Benjin Maza (Othello) as Ted.

Reimagined for Australian audiences, this highly anticipated version of Peter and the Starcatcher blurs the lines between reality and fantasy, traversing oceans of mystical mermaids and lands of curious creatures. Originally developed by Disney Theatrical Group and written by renowned stage writer and 4-time Tony Award nominee Rick Elice (Water for Elephants, Jersey Boys, The Addams Family), with music by Wayne Barker, this all-new production is directed by Helpmann Award-nominated Australian director and Dead Puppet Society co-founder David Morton (Holding Achilles, The Wider Earth).
